Collectible coins encompass a wide range of numismatic items, often valued for their historical significance, rarity, and intrinsic metal content. The United States offers various collectible coins, including the 100 One Hundred Dollar Platinum Eagle, which was first issued in 1997 and features the signature of the U.S. Mint's Chief Engraver. The 2019 Platinum Eagle continues this tradition, depicting a modern design on its obverse and a heraldic eagle on the reverse. The market for these coins can be influenced by factors such as demand, condition, and mintage numbers.
